Transaction d750d7817ec206291b3e83a62d2de5d5633f81a33c22742271e52159c35bb348
1 Input
2 Outputs
- d750d7817ec206291b3e83a62d2de5d5633f81a33c22742271e52159c35bb348:0
- d750d7817ec206291b3e83a62d2de5d5633f81a33c22742271e52159c35bb348:1
value 808938
address 18jSSNDP5TUnt4T8rXg1Sp2EQfH6s2dHXi
value 28903054
address 3MPRQoQJtSxMLtDGgqoffHqh1sFvud5tCT